Titled “Andromake,” the play has been adapted by famous Norwegian author and dramatist Jon Fosse and directed by Jean-Marie Lejude, who successfully created the play “La Fontaine Fable” at the Hanoi Academy of Theatre and Cinema on the occasion of the school’s 50th anniversary.
The play will be performed in both Vietnamese and French by eight actors from the two countries, including Catriona Smith, Ched Chenouga, Gisele Torterolo, Pierre Olivier, Lam Tung, Vinh Xuong, Ngan Hoa and Khanh Linh.
First performed in 1667, “Andromaque” tells the tragic story of Andromaque, a woman who was detained in the enemy’s land but remains loyal to her late husband Hector through her love for her son, Astyanax.
“Andromake” will be held at the Hanoi Opera House, located at 1 Trang Tien Street, before moving to France in 2012.
